A member asked:

If diazepam is showing up in a ua while trying to get into suboxone treatment will i be turned away? it was a prescription, not taking them anymore.

6 doctors weighed in across 3 answers
Dr. Linda Callaghan answered

Specializes in Addiction Medicine

Not necessarily.: You must bring the bottle which has the name of the prescriber so your Suboxone doctor will see. You will need to bring the bottles of all your current and previous medications so he will decide whether it is safe to combine them with Suboxone.
